Microtome is an important laboratory equipment which is widely used in pathology, biology, medicine and other fields. Its main function is to cut tissue samples into thin and uniform sections for microscopic observation and research. The working principle of Microtome mainly involves many aspects such as machinery, transmission and control.

I. Basic Structure

Microtome is mainly composed of base, knife frame, slicing disk, transmission system, control system and other parts. Among them, the knife frame is responsible for installing the slicing knife, the slicing disk is the place where the samples come into contact with the knife, the transmission system drives the knife frame to carry out the cutting action, and the control system is responsible for the operation control of the whole equipment.

Working Principle

1. Transmission system: the motor drives the transmission belt to drive the slicing disk to rotate. The transmission system usually adopts precision bearings and gears to ensure stable transmission speed and force.
2. Knife holder and blade: The knife holder is fixed on the upper part of the Microtome, and the blade is mounted on the knife holder. When the transmission system works, the blade makes a cutting movement.
3. sample fixation: the sample to be cut is fixed on the slicing disk, and the position in contact with the blade is the cutting point.
4. control system: the control system is the core part of the Microtome, which can control the start, stop, speed, etc. of the equipment. The operator can input commands through the control panel to realize automatic or semi-automatic operation.
5. Cutting process: When the equipment starts, the motor drives the transmission system to rotate the blade for cutting. The operator can get the required slice thickness by adjusting the position and angle of the slicing disk and the depth of the blade.
6. Auxiliary devices: Some advanced Microtomes are also equipped with auxiliary devices such as automatic liquid refilling and automatic slice trimming to improve working efficiency and slice quality.

Advantageous features

Microtome has the advantages of easy operation, high cutting precision and uniform slice thickness. Compared with the traditional manual slicing method, the Microtome greatly improves the working efficiency and slice quality, and reduces the human error.

Application fields

Microtome is widely used in pathology, biology and other fields of research and teaching work, especially in pathological diagnosis plays an important role. Through the Microtome, doctors can get clear tissue slices, which provide an important basis for the diagnosis and treatment of diseases.
